Ilkley station is equipped with several amenities to ensure a comfortable journey. The ticket office is open daily, with varying hours, providing both ticket machines and online ticket collection services. For those requiring accessibility support, the station boasts step-free access and accessible ticket machines, ensuring that everyone can navigate the station with ease. It’s a welcoming environment for all, with induction loops and wheelchair access, though you might want to plan ahead for facilities like toilets and waiting rooms, as these are somewhat limited.
For cyclists, there's secure bicycle storage with CCTV surveillance, and for drivers, a 24-hour car park managed by Northern, with both regular and accessible spaces. Although there’s no CCTV in the car park, the town of Ilkley and its community is generally considered safe and secure. The station also offers basic refreshment options, though it lacks an ATM and other shopping amenities, so plan accordingly before starting your journey.
Beyond the station, Ilkley is well-connected with local transport options to facilitate your onward journey. A taxi stand is conveniently located outside the station, perfect for a quick departure. For bus travel, you can catch services from the adjacent bus interchange, offering routes throughout the region. Winchfield Station is equipped to meet the needs of various travelers. The station features a ticket office operating from 06:10 to 12:00 on weekdays and 08:00 to 12:00 on Saturdays, while Sundays are closed. Ticket machines are available for service outside these hours, allowing for both ticket purchase and collection. These machines are accessible, offering services compatible with Disabled Persons Railcards, ensuring inclusivity for all passengers. Induction loops are also installed to assist those with hearing impairments.
Although Winchfield Station doesn't offer refreshment facilities or shops, it provides essential services like accessible toilets and waiting rooms to make your wait more comfortable. Take advantage of the heated waiting area within the booking hall, which is open during ticket office hours. For those looking to plan ahead, the station offers public Wi-Fi—find hotspots with ease using resources linked from the station's webpage.
Traveling from Winchfield doesn't stop at the train service; the station is well-integrated with other transport options to ease onward journeys. Have you heard about the Hartley Wintney Community Bus? It provides seven commuter services daily, offering convenient connections between Winchfield Station and the village during peak hours. Timetables are posted at the station, but can also be accessed online here.
For those times when trains aren't operating, a rail replacement service is available from the Station Forecourt off Station Road, ensuring you remain mobile and efficient even during planned disruptions. Planning and printable resources for your journey are readily available here.
